Top 5 Emerging Markets for Wholesale Products in 2023
As the global economy continues to evolve, new markets are emerging as significant players in the wholesale product sector. Recognizing these opportunities can give your business a competitive advantage.
1. Vietnam
Vietnam has rapidly become a hub for manufacturing and exporting goods, especially textiles and electronics. The country's growing economy and favorable trade agreements make it an attractive destination for wholesale products.
2. India
With a population exceeding 1.3 billion, India presents an enormous market potential. The rise of e-commerce and a shift towards digital payments are transforming the way wholesale transactions occur.
3. Indonesia
Indonesia's strategic location and abundant natural resources have made it a key player in the global supply chain. The wholesale sector, particularly in agriculture and textiles, is thriving.
4. Brazil
As the largest economy in South America, Brazil offers diverse opportunities in wholesale products. The country’s infrastructure investment is continually enhancing trade logistics.
5. Mexico
Proximity to the United States and extensive trade agreements have positioned Mexico as a crucial player in B2B wholesale operations, particularly in manufacturing.
